Once AGAIN --- how do you expect anybody to make a splash in a system owned and operated by the Duopoly?

Hm?

They'd have to literally buy their way into it, i.e. compete with all the cash in the coffers of both the DNC and RNC, including buying their own media outlets, lots of 'em. Even Rump for all his bluster about how supposedly rich he is, didn't take that route. He picked a Duopoly horse and rode it. And he too solicited donations to do that.

So you'd need somebody way richer than that. And that's not bloody likely to equate to somebody who's either (a) capable of relating to the common people or (b) not somebody who got that rich via some specialty business venture which is in no way a prep for taking a gig with the opposite interests (witness the present clusterfuck).

I just don't see how your query as you've put it is in any way realistic.

Ross Perot tried to be that guy in 1992. He got just under 19% of the national vote, yet carried exactly zero in the Electoral College --- which is one of the prime instruments by which the Duopoly protects itself from any independent threat. He tried to do it again four years later and the Duopoly machine made sure he was no more than a whimper.

Finally, your pity party about "no one" seems to not understand that this is not even an election year. Nevertheless, a quick-Wiki renders a list of candies already vying for the nominations of the American Solidarity Party and the Green Party, or, if you want to stay strictly on "independent means no party at all" definition, there are two more listed there who have already declared independent of any party. This cannot be defined as "no one". Search took about half a second to find that much -- a year and a half out.

Last person to attain the Presidency without a party was Andrew Jackson,.and he was riding the coattails of his military history in a weak field when the two existing parties were in the process of collapsing. And that was a different time, 191 years ago, and once he got in there he and his protegé van Buren thought it expedient to form his supporters INTO a party. Like it or not -- and we don't --- the system is rigged by a Duopoly that runs everything. The sooner we all realize that, the sooner it can be dismantled.
